What is a contract remote public relations professional?

Contract Remote Public Relations jobs involve managing and enhancing an organization’s or client’s public image on a contractual basis while working remotely. Professionals in these roles handle tasks such as media outreach, press release writing, crisis communication, and social media management, all from a location outside the traditional office environment. These positions offer flexibility and are often project-based, allowing PR specialists to work with multiple clients or agencies. Employers typically seek candidates with strong communication skills, PR experience, and the ability to work independently. Remote contract PR jobs can be found in various industries, including technology, healthcare, and nonprofit sectors.

How do contract remote public relations professionals coordinate with clients and team members to manage campaigns effectively?

Contract remote public relations professionals often rely on digital collaboration tools and regular virtual meetings to stay aligned with clients and team members. They frequently use project management platforms, video conferencing, and instant messaging to ensure timely communication and transparency. Maintaining clear documentation and setting expectations early are essential for managing deliverables and responding swiftly to media opportunities. Building strong relationships virtually can be a challenge, but consistent updates and proactive outreach help foster trust and collaboration.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a contract remote public relations professional?

To thrive as a Contract Remote Public Relations professional, you need strong writing, media relations, and strategic communication skills, often supported by a degree in communications, public relations, or a related field. Familiarity with PR management platforms (such as Cision or Meltwater), social media management tools, and virtual collaboration systems is typically required. Exceptional organization, adaptability, and proactive communication are standout soft skills for building relationships and managing campaigns remotely. These skills and qualities are vital for effectively promoting client messages, maintaining media connections, and delivering measurable results in a remote and dynamic environment.

Job description

What you need to know about this position:

  • The Contract Specialist oversees the implementation and operations of payor relations and payor contract management for the health system.
  • This position is responsible for entering payor contracts into the current contract management system(s) keeping them current and updated at all times while also maintaining a master calendar of all payor contracts.
  • The Contract Specialist is responsible for monitoring all payor performance as it relates to contractual variances and recommending areas of opportunity to improve contract and reimbursement optimization to various stakeholders.
  • This position is responsible for communicating to key individuals throughout the health system regarding payor’s new and/or updated policy/procedure.
  • The hourly range for this position is between $26.24 and $41.92, annualized to $54,579 and $87,194.  Individual compensation is determined for this position through years of directly relevant experience.  The hourly compensation is only a portion of the total rewards package and a comprehensive benefits program is available for qualifying positions.
  • This salaried position would require you to work 40 hours per week, 8:00am-5:00pm, Monday through Friday and is 100% remote.

What is required for this position:

  • Bachelor’s Degree or 5-7+ years of experience in areas of network management, Contracting, hospital and physician reimbursement, contract management, managed care, payor credentialing, billing, coding, and overall revenue cycle required.
  • Progressively responsible work experience in healthcare in a Provider Relations/Customer Service environment or equivalent role required.
  • Comprehensive knowledge of healthcare managed care principles and understanding of contract language, fee schedules, reimbursement methodologies, Current Procedural Technologies (CPTs), Healthcare Common Procedure Coding Systems (HCPCS), Ambulatory Payment Classifications (APCs), Diagnosis-Related Groups (DRGs), and Outpatient Prospective Payment System (OPPS) required.
  • Epic – Resolute Hospital Billing Expected Reimbursement Contracts Administration Certification or Resolute Hospital Billing Expected Reimbursement Contracts Administration Accredited-Remote required within six (6) months of hire.
